Transaction fcf3c903863a8cccf7a85623f7b89963f7bf1194aab5039a357ef10d68bc762e
1 Input
1 Output
-
fcf3c903863a8cccf7a85623f7b89963f7bf1194aab5039a357ef10d68bc762e:0
- value
- 59226537
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 932def128b1807d4d507999f38c68bfc16cb96e8 OP_EQUAL
- address
- 3F7EHHTQst9DAJcXPKRQxWYHdW9kr3wKzU